Nationally best-selling fantasy legend Mercedes Lackey created a vivid, dynamic fusion of the Upper and Lower Kingdoms of ancient Egypt with the most exciting, authentic and believable portrayal of dragons ever imagined. In the second novel in Mercedes Lackey's richly conceived Dragon Jousters series, the dragonrider Vetch escapes to Alta, the subjugated land of his birth. There, he hopes to teach his people to raise and train dragons - and build an army that will liberate his homeland.

Vetch returns to the land of his birth, an area Mercedes Lackey has made very much like Earth's ancient Upper and Lower Egypt, only here "there be dragons. "
In Alta Fetch again finds life living with Dragon Jousters, but as an equal, not a serf. He refused to drug dragons into submission but searches for hawk and horse enthusiasts that try to bond with all the intelligence of each. They find that dragons can almost read their riders intentions.
Fetch also learns there is some process the mages are putting people through that drains the gifted population of their powers. He comes up with an idea to isolate a hatching and all needed to care for their growth but requires help of a top donor to support his ideas for both the new training ideas and examining the mages new efforts.
I found the added growth of many new plot ideas to add to the improvement of Alta!
